Understanding the Role of Lithonia Lighting Wall Packs in Exterior Illumination

Exterior lighting plays a crucial role in enhancing safety, security, and aesthetics around commercial and residential properties. Among the various lighting solutions available, Lithonia Lighting wall packs have become a popular choice for their durability, energy efficiency, and versatility. These fixtures are designed to provide broad, uniform illumination on building exteriors, walkways, and parking areas.

Wall packs are typically mounted on the exterior walls of buildings, positioned to cast light downward and outward, reducing dark spots and improving visibility. Lithonia Lighting, a trusted brand in the industry, offers a range of wall pack models that incorporate advanced LED technology, ensuring long-lasting performance and reduced energy consumption. The energy efficiency of these fixtures not only contributes to lower electricity bills but also aligns with sustainable practices, making them an ideal choice for environmentally-conscious consumers.

Common Mistakes in Lighting Design and How to Avoid Them

Overlooking Proper Light Distribution and Placement

One of the most frequent errors in using wall packs is neglecting the importance of proper light distribution. Wall packs must be strategically placed to ensure even illumination without creating glare or dark zones. Incorrect mounting height or positioning can result in uneven lighting, which compromises both safety and visual comfort.

For example, mounting a wall pack too low may cause excessive brightness at eye level, leading to glare that can temporarily blind pedestrians or drivers. Conversely, placing the fixture too high might reduce the intensity of light on the ground, creating shadows and unsafe conditions. Lithonia Lighting wall packs are designed with specific beam angles and lumen outputs, so selecting the correct model for the intended mounting height and application is critical. Additionally, considering the surrounding architecture and landscaping can enhance the effectiveness of the lighting. For instance, a well-placed wall pack can highlight architectural features or pathways, creating a more inviting and secure environment while maintaining functionality.

Ignoring the Importance of Color Temperature

Color temperature significantly influences the ambiance and functionality of outdoor spaces. Lithonia Lighting offers wall packs with various color temperatures, typically ranging from warm white (around 3000K) to cool white (up to 5000K). Selecting the wrong color temperature can affect visibility and the overall perception of the environment.

For instance, cooler color temperatures (4000K to 5000K) are often preferred for security lighting because they enhance contrast and improve the detection of movement. However, excessively cool light can appear harsh and uninviting in residential settings. Warmer temperatures create a softer, more welcoming atmosphere but may not provide the same level of clarity for security purposes. Understanding the context and purpose of the lighting area helps in choosing the appropriate color temperature. Furthermore, it’s beneficial to consider how color temperature interacts with other elements in the environment, such as landscaping or building materials, as this can dramatically alter the overall aesthetic and functionality of the space.

Neglecting Energy Efficiency and Controls

While Lithonia Lighting wall packs are inherently energy-efficient due to their LED technology, failing to incorporate lighting controls can lead to unnecessary energy consumption and higher operational costs. Common oversights include the absence of motion sensors, photocells, or timers that adjust lighting based on occupancy or ambient light conditions.

Integrating controls not only reduces energy waste but also extends the lifespan of the fixtures. For example, a wall pack equipped with a photocell will automatically turn off during daylight hours, preventing needless electricity usage. Motion sensors can activate lighting only when movement is detected, enhancing security while conserving power. Designing lighting systems with these controls in mind is essential for sustainable and cost-effective operation. Technical Considerations for Optimal Wall Pack Performance

Choosing the Right Lumen Output

Lumen output determines the brightness of a wall pack and must be matched to the specific needs of the space. Over-lighting can cause light pollution and discomfort, while under-lighting reduces visibility and security. Lithonia Lighting offers wall packs with a wide range of lumen outputs, from lower-intensity models suitable for residential pathways to high-output fixtures designed for commercial and industrial applications.

Designers should calculate the required lumens based on the area size, mounting height, and the desired illumination level, often measured in foot-candles or lux. For example, parking lots typically require 1 to 2 foot-candles, while building perimeters may need slightly higher levels for security. Using photometric data provided by Lithonia Lighting helps ensure the selected wall pack meets these requirements.

Ensuring Proper IP Rating and Durability

Wall packs are exposed to various environmental conditions, including rain, dust, and temperature fluctuations. Selecting fixtures with an appropriate Ingress Protection (IP) rating is vital to guarantee long-term reliability. Lithonia Lighting wall packs generally feature IP65 or higher ratings, indicating strong resistance to water jets and dust ingress.

Ignoring this aspect can lead to premature fixture failure and increased maintenance costs. Additionally, considering the material and finish of the wall pack is important for corrosion resistance, especially in coastal or industrial environments. Opting for models with robust construction ensures the lighting system remains effective over time.

Addressing Glare and Light Trespass

Glare occurs when light is excessively bright or poorly directed, causing visual discomfort or reduced visibility. Light trespass refers to unwanted light spilling into adjacent properties or natural habitats, potentially causing disturbances. Both issues are common complaints associated with exterior lighting but can be mitigated through thoughtful design.

Lithonia Lighting wall packs often include features such as shields or louvers to control light distribution and minimize glare. Positioning fixtures to direct light downward and away from windows or sensitive areas helps reduce light trespass. Employing full cutoff or cutoff-style wall packs further confines light to the intended zones, enhancing neighborly relations and complying with local lighting ordinances.

Practical Tips for Successful Installation and Maintenance

Following Manufacturer Guidelines and Local Codes

Adhering to Lithonia Lighting’s installation instructions is fundamental to achieving optimal performance and safety. These guidelines cover aspects such as mounting height, wiring, and fixture orientation. Ignoring them can void warranties and lead to hazardous conditions.

Additionally, compliance with local building codes and lighting regulations is mandatory. Many municipalities have specific requirements regarding light levels, fixture types, and control systems to reduce light pollution and energy consumption. Consulting with local authorities or lighting professionals ensures that the wall pack installation meets all legal standards.

Regular Inspection and Cleaning

Maintaining wall packs is essential to preserve their efficiency and longevity. Dirt, dust, and debris accumulation on lenses can significantly diminish light output and alter beam patterns. Routine cleaning, using appropriate materials to avoid scratching or damaging the fixture, helps sustain optimal illumination.

Periodic inspections also allow for early detection of issues such as corrosion, loose connections, or damaged components. Prompt repairs or replacements prevent system failures and maintain safety standards.

Upgrading Existing Systems for Enhanced Performance

Many properties still rely on outdated wall pack models with inefficient lighting technology. Retrofitting these with modern Lithonia Lighting LED wall packs can yield substantial benefits, including lower energy bills, improved light quality, and reduced maintenance.

When upgrading, it is important to reassess the lighting design to incorporate current best practices and technological advancements. This may involve adjusting fixture placement, integrating smart controls, or selecting different color temperatures to better suit the environment.
